当我们需要在外地访问在局域网內的服务器时需要进行内网穿透 ngrok才能远程连接。常用的内网穿透 ngrok工具是ngrok下载地址是:
需要现在官网注册一个账户,并生成一个Tunnel Authtoken:
下载後并解压出
ngrok
文件
1.使用SSH连接远程服务器
因为SSH使用的是TCP协议,需要需要一个TCP隧道:
本地机器输入SSH命令即可连接远程服务器:
2.访问远程机器的Web垺务
此时适用于本地的localhost上已经部署好了Web程序想要在部署到公网之前先测试。此时可以使用ngrok代理http服务远程机器可以访问本地的localhost。